hi, I've updated the Documentation for the SOAP Integration.
You can create now moderated Rooms: http://code.google.com/p/openmeetings/wiki/SoapMethods#addRoomWithModeration And you can specify users to be Moderator by default: http://code.google.com/p/openmeetings/wiki/SoapMethods#setUserObjectAndGenerateRoomHash the new URL is different from previous integrations. Old mechanism will still work but its recommended to update.
